Description

The Alto de la Cruz is a natural viewpoint located in Peñalba de Santiago, in the municipality of Ponferrada, province of León, within the mountain landscape of the Montes Aquilianos and the environment of the Valle del Silencio. Its hillside location allows a wide view over the valley and the peaks surrounding the village, one of the most unique enclaves of El Bierzo for its isolation and strong landscape personality. It is a panoramic point designed to stop and contemplate the abrupt relief, the forests and the succession of mountains that frame Peñalba de Santiago. The interest of the visit lies in the reading of the landscape: the head of the valley, the slopes that descend towards the stream and the feeling of mountainous enclosure that characterizes this nucleus, seated in a narrow valley bottom and protected by notable elevations. The area is also interesting for its relationship with a village of high heritage value, declared a Historic-Artistic Site and a Site of Cultural Interest, in an environment where nature and traditional architecture are clearly integrated. The viewpoint thus complements the visit to the whole of Peñalba de Santiago, offering an outside perspective of the enclave and its immediate geographical context. Its relevance is above all scenic and touristic: it functions as a window to the mountainous and secluded character of the town, and helps to understand why Peñalba de Santiago is one of the most recognized destinations of Leon's rural heritage.

How to get there

By car: from Peñalba de Santiago you can access by the local road that goes up to the village; the viewpoint is in the high area of the access and does not require to reach a large nucleus of services. Parking: it is advisable to leave the car in the authorized areas or on the permitted edge of the access to Peñalba; there is no specific official parking. Trail: the above-mentioned uphill section is almost 3 km and has an average gradient of 370 m, with an average gradient of 12.4%; approximate difficulty, medium-high.. Footwear: mountain boots or sneakers with good soles. Best season: spring, autumn and clear winter days. Warnings: steep slope, winding road surface and possible local traffic on the access; do not block the path or leave the margins.
